lms-backend/modules/structs/roles.go

39 lines
614 B
Go

package structs
type RolesResponse struct {
Roles []HelperRole
}
type HelperRole struct {
Id string
Permissions []uint16
Users []HelperRoleUser
}
type HelperRoleUser struct {
FirstName string
LastName string
ProfilePictureUrl string
}
/*
type HelperRole struct {
Id string
Name string
Master bool
Permissions []uint16
Users []HelperRoleUser
}
type HelperRoleUser struct {
FirstName string
LastName string
ProfilePictureUrl string
}
// swagger:model CreateRoleRequest
type CreateRoleRequest struct {
Name string
}
*/